I have purchased a New HTC E9+ Plus Mobile from Flipkart .com of Rs.34, 999/- on 22-06-2015 Firstly i have paid extra for their express next day delivery. but i have received the mobile after 2 days. When i have asked to return to refund my extra monEy, they "DENIED". After receiving the mobile, the mobile charger was found not working - DEFECTIVE. I went to HTC service as per Suggested by Flipkart Customer care person 2 times. But HTC service center has DENIED to take the mobile as it was purchased from FLIPKART & NOT FROM A DEALER. When i have highlighted the Issue with FLIPKART customer care person on the same day (11-07-2015) they told me that i will resolve the issue by 15-07-2015. On 13-07-2015, i received a call from FLIPKART executive stating that FLIPKART WILL TAKE BACK THE MOBILE WITH IN 3 DAY & REFUND ME THE MONEY AFTER 8 WORKING DAYS IN MY ACCOUNT. . I HAVE ALREADY PAID HUGE AMOUNT ON TEMPERED GLASS & BACK COVER FOR THE MOBILE. ALSO IT IS A BIG HARASSMENT FOR ME AFTER BUYING SUCH PREMIUM PHONE. I AM FACING A BIG HARASSMENT FOR LAST 20 DAYS & UNABLE TO USE TO PROPERLY FOR WHICH I HAVE PAID A HUGE AMOUNT. HIGHLY RECOMMENCED NOT TO PURCHASE FROM FLIPKART.
This review is after 4 days use of the device. First of all the outer look will beat any phone in the market, sleek, appropriately combined with colors (Gold Sepia looks the best). Display is very vibrant and everything appears real in the screen. Second comes the Camera. No doubt a 20 MP camera does all the wonders required on daily life. Even there are certain modes which are available on DSLR cameras only. Third comes the battery. 2800 MAH battery is enough for full day use even if you are a hardcore mobile user. Here are my own examples- Day 1:- Received in the evening a 5 PM and when opened, the battery was 58 %. I switched on the phone, configured it with Wi-Fi and used continuously up to 10 PM via Wi-Fi only downloading the apps, doing personalization and transferring all the things from old phone and the battery left at 10 PM was 21 %. Day-2:- Fully charged previous night and the battery remaining in the morning was 89 % then I started the day again at 8 AM with the same curiosity things on a new phone and kept 3G on permanently for whole day and using Whatsapp, Facebook, net surfing and at the end of the day at 5 PM, the battery remaining was 39% which lasted for whole night and needed charging in the morning. Day-3:- started with 100 % battery at 7 AM and installed about 100 apps and configured all of them, watched videos, taken pictures, whatsapp was permanently on and 3G was also permanently on. Made my own themes and did various things not allowing the screen to be off even for a second i.e. used it continuously for 5 hours doing all the things and screen was kept open for 5 hours continuously without a blink of screen. Any other phone would have begged for charging and would have heated up to boiling point but this one left with 27 % battery and cool like was kept in AC. All these things were apart from the calls I received and dialed which is average 40 calls before noon and 40 after noon. P.S. :- If you switch off data connection, you’ll wonder from where it’s operating i.e. battery is almost not at all used. I don’t think anyone would require more rigorous use of phone than this. So you can be sure of battery lasting the day long irrespective of your field. The features don’t need to be told as are already mentioned. Yes corrections are as below- 1. It’s a dual SIM phone not a single SIM 2. SD card support is up to 2 TB and not only 128 GB 3. The weight of the phone is 135 gm and not 150 gm All these features are not available even on high budget phones up to 55 K so you should grab it for sure. Cons:- 1. The phone is large in size and its because the bezel is much more. The size can be reduced by almost an Inch if HTC would have designed it precisely. 2. User Interface is not as much appealing as is in Samsung premium phones and LG premium phones. I was using LG G2 and I will still declare it a winner over E9+ on inner appearance of the phone. 3. HTC is giving a charger with 1 AMP adapter which will require about 2 and half hours to charge the phone to full. They should have given at least 2 AMP so that charging time could have been reduced to half. Overall it’s a treat on 35 K. You won’t get such features in this budget and that too from a renowned company like HTC. So don’t think, just go for it.
